Program Description

Selected volunteers will work with the beautiful Cheetah, the world's fastest land mammal and one of Africa's most treasured cats. Situated in the Strand you'll lend a hand in broader efforts to support Cheetah conservation, with tasks that include educating visitors. You'll also have the chance to get up close and personal with the site's resident cheetahs.
- Assist in the day-to-day care of the animals, including meal preparation
- Help educate visitors to the facility about animal conservation and the nature of the Cheetah
- Take care of the Anatolian dogs on site, cleaning up feeding areas and holding enclosures
- Host project guests, including introducing them to the cheetahs

Qualifications

- An enthusiastic personality with a genuine compassion for animal welfare
- Commitment to a 5-day work week on a rotation basis, volunteering from 9am to 5.15pm (6pm in the summer months)
- Minimum 6-week time commitment
- For safety reasons you must have at least an advanced (C1) level of English
- Signed Volunteer Placement Agreement
